Sheet M with the twentieth and twenty-first triumphal wagons and the eighteenth and nineteenth animals. Twentieth triumphal wagon with the continent of Africa. Eighteenth animal: rhinoceros. Twenty-first triumphal wagon with the continent of America. Nineteenth animal: tiger. Marked: M / 38-41. Part of the procession for the celebration on May 30, 1767, of the 700th anniversary of Saint Macarius, patron of the city of Ghent and protector against the plague.
